This is the standard manual method that guarantees the highest fidelity, often used by professional colorists. It involves using a "HaldCLUT" image—a neutral reference image that contains all possible color values.

Always place your conversion LUT at the end of your node or effect chain. Perform your primary corrections (fixing exposure, fixing white balance, stretching flat log footage to Rec.709) before the LUT node.
